[发明专利]一种工业蓝牙网络系统及组网方法有效
申请号: | 201310566493.0 | 申请日: | 2014-01-26 |
公开(公告)号: | CN103684938B | 公开(公告)日: | 2017-03-08 |
发明(设计)人: | 秦元庆;朱钱祥;周纯杰 | 申请(专利权)人: | 华中科技大学 |
主分类号: | H04L12/28 | 分类号: | H04L12/28;H04L29/06;H04B5/00;H04W12/02 |
代理公司: | 华中科技大学专利中心42201 | 代理人: | 朱仁玲 |
地址: | 430074 湖北*** | 国省代码: | 湖北;42 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 工业 蓝牙 网络 系统 组网 方法 | ||
技术领域
本发明涉及无线网络组网技术,具体涉及一种适用于工业环境的蓝牙网络系统及组网方法。
背景技术
随着无线技术的飞速发展和日趋成熟,越来越多的工业场所采用无线技术作为有线技术的补充,特别在一些布线不方便的场合,如移动或旋转的设备之间的通信,河沟对面、公路或铁路对面的设备之间的通信等,无线技术得到了广泛的应用。采用无线技术有着如下的优点:布线简单、系统使用期长、可靠性高。目前应用于工业场合的无线技术有WIFI、蓝牙、ZigBee等等,WIFI适用于远距离高速率的数据传输,蓝牙适用于短距离中速率的可靠性要求较高的数据传输,而ZigBee则适用于低速率多节点的数据传输,工程师可以根据不同应用场景的需求采用不同的无线技术。
蓝牙是一种全球通用的短距离无线通信技术,其设备类型按照通信距离分成两类:Class1以及Class2,分别对应100米和10米的通信距离,不同的应用场合采用不同类型的蓝牙设备。蓝牙工作在2.4GHz频段,该频段免费供工业、医学以及科研领域使用。一个蓝牙主站可以同时和七个活动的蓝牙从站之间保持异步无连接链路(Asynchronous Connectionless Link,ACL),即蓝牙主站可以同与与七个从站进行通信,一个主站及多个从站构成了一个蓝牙微微网。对于ACL链路通信的可靠性,蓝牙物理层采用了跳频策略、前向纠错、编码优化等机制,使得蓝牙通信链路抗干扰性好、可靠性高。以上的机制保证了蓝牙技术能满足工业应用的集中式控制及可靠性要求。然而,将蓝牙应用于工业生产还需要解决以下问题:如何设计蓝牙设备组网机制以保证蓝牙通信的安全性,以及如何提高网络的健壮性和可维护性。
发明内容
本发明的目的是提供一种蓝牙网络的组网方法和系统,旨在满足工业生产的安全性、健壮性和可维护性的需求。
按照本发明的一个方面,提供一种工业蓝牙网络系统,用于工业场所中的通信,其包括蓝牙主站和由其管理的多个蓝牙从站,并且每个蓝牙从站都具备一个相应的网络密钥装置(NETWORK_KEY,简称N_K),其中,
所述网络密钥装置用于实现所述蓝牙主站与其管理的多个蓝牙从站之间的组网过滤参数的交互;
所述蓝牙主站、从站均包括:
中央控制单元(MCU),通过所述网络密钥装置中存储的过滤参数控制蓝牙模块进行网络管理和无线数据收发;以及
蓝牙模块,用来运行蓝牙协议栈,并通过主机控制接口(Host Controller Interface,HCI)接受所述中央控制单元的控制命令以及接收其它蓝牙主站或从站发送过来的无线帧;
并且,所述蓝牙主站还包括:
网络配置接口电路,用来设置当前微微网ID、从站的逻辑地址以及主站管理的从站数目;以及RS485/CAN总线接口电路,用于该蓝牙主站与网络内的其他微微网主站组建成有线网络。
作为本发明的改进,所述N_K为非易失存储器,通过总线与所述蓝牙主站或从站进行通信,其存储有加密后的组网过滤参数,包括当前微微网ID、主站蓝牙地址及从站逻辑地址。
按照本发明的另一方面,提供一种应用上述的工业蓝牙网络系统进行组网的方法,其中,所述蓝牙主站执行如下步骤:
1)配置与该蓝牙主站所管理的所有蓝牙从站相应的N_K,将主站蓝牙地址、当前微微网ID和从站逻辑地址加密写入各蓝牙从站对应的N_K;
2)中央控制单元将蓝牙模块的搜索过滤参数设置为当前微微网ID,命令其执行搜索操作:若蓝牙模块搜索到的从站设备类型(CLASS_of_DEVICE)信息不符合搜索过滤参数,则不将该从站的蓝牙地址信息上传到中央控制单元;蓝牙模块搜索完毕后,若中央控制单元得到的从站蓝牙地址信息个数少于蓝牙主站应管理的从站数目,则命令蓝牙模块重新执行搜索操作,否则执行第3)步;
3)所述蓝牙主站向搜索到的所有从站逐一发送ACL链路建立请求帧,等待所有从站接收该请求并建立与它之间的ACL链路,由此主站与从站组成一个微微网。
作为本发明的改进,,所述步骤1)具体为:
1a)上电后,中央控制单元和蓝牙模块之间建立BCSP链路;
1b)所述蓝牙主站检测其本身是否插入了N_K,若是,执行第1c)步,否则执行第2)步;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华中科技大学,未经华中科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201310566493.0/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种拓扑网络的两级分块方法
- 下一篇:一种数据包监测方法及装置